The Fat Boy Chronicles
The Fat Boy Chronicles is a film about Jimmy Winterpock, an obese high-school student who deals with bullying and trying to lose weight. The film is inspired by a true story about an obese 9th grader in Cincinnati and a novel and film were released in 2010, and was later released on Netflix. The movie received mixed reviews, with users on Rotten Tomatoes giving the movie a 49% "Rotten" rating.
Plot
Jimmy Winterpock always gets teased by the football team for being overweight at 188 pounds and only 5 ft 5. As a school assignment he writes about it in his journal. He soon meets a girl named Sable Moore who, as the story goes on, Jimmy learns that she cuts herself. After making quick friends, they start to go to church together. Eventually, Jimmy begins jogging with his father, with a goal to lose 38 pounds. Paul Grove, Jimmy's friend was the one who told him to do this. Paul talks Jimmy into sneaking out to a party. Later Paul's father commits suicide. Paul runs away and gets injured in an accident in Colorado. Jimmy tutors Robb Thurman, who is the football captain. Robb, because of this, tells his teammates not to harass Jimmy any more, as they become friends.Characters
- Jimmy Winterpock – A normally depressed boy outside of home and church, he is the protagonist. As the main character of the book and film, Jimmy tries to lose weight.
- Paul Grove – Jimmy's best friend a troubled teen with drug addict parents, he struggles to find meaning in his life.
- Sable Moore – Jimmy's love interest and later girlfriend, she has mental issues and cuts herself to heal her mental scars.
- Robb Thuman – A high school quarterback for the team, as well as a bully who, after a few tutoring sessions with Jimmy, starts to protect him.
- Allen Winterpock – Jimmy's father who is also somewhat overweight, who runs with him during their jogs.
- Marianne Winterpock – Jimmy's mother.
- Dr. Jeffords – The doctor that examined Jimmy.
- Nate Hammer – A punk teen who has bullied Jimmy since middle school.

- Ms. Pope – Jimmy’s high school English teacher. She assigns Jimmy to write 3 half pages a day in his journal. This journal is a driving point of the film.
- Whitney Elliot – A popular cheerleader who despite pretending to be Jimmy’s friend is another bully.
- Allen Zuckerman – Another victim of bullying at Jimmy’s school. After discovering they ride the same bus, Jimmy and Allen become friends.
